Aracılığıyla paylaş


CDC::GetTextExtentExPointI

Belirli bir alan içinde sığacak ve bir dizi metin uzanım ile her bu karakterleri doldurur belirtilen bir dizenin karakter sayısını alır.

BOOL GetTextExtentExPointI(
   LPWORD pgiIn,
   int cgi,
   int nMaxExtent,
   LPINT lpnFit,
   LPINT alpDx,
   LPSIZE lpSize
) const;

Parametreler

  • pgiIn
    Kapsamlarını alınabilecek olan glif indis dizisi için bir işaretçi.

  • cgi
    Göre sıralanmasını dizisinde glif sayısını belirtir pgiIn.

  • nMaxExtent
    En çok izin verilen genişliği biçimlendirilen dizeyi mantıksal birimler cinsinden belirtir.

  • lpnFit
    Bir tarafından belirtilen alana sığacak karakter sayısı sayısı alır bir tamsayýya iþaretçi nMaxExtent.When lpnFit is NULL, nMaxExtent is ignored.

  • alpDx
    Kısmi glif kapsamlarını aldığı dizisi için bir işaretçi.Glif indices dizisini başlangıcını ve biri tarafından belirtilen alana sığacak glifleri arasındaki mantıksal birimler cinsinden Uzaklık dizisindeki her öğesi verir nMaxExtent.Bu dizi en az sayıda öğeleri tarafından belirtilen glif indis olarak olması gerekir, ancak cgi, fonksiyon dizi tarafından belirtildiği gibi sadece sayıda glif indices kapsamları ile doldurur lpnFit.LpnDx olan null, işlev kısmi dize genişlikleri hesaplaması yapmıyor.

  • lpSize
    İşaretçi bir BOYUTU mantıksal birimler cinsinden boyutları glif indis dizisi alır yapısı.Bu değer olamaz null.

Dönüş Değeri

Sıfır olmayan bir değer işlevi başarılı olursa; Aksi halde 0.

Notlar

Bu üye işlev işlevini işlevselliğini öykünür GetTextExtentExPointI, açıklandığı gibi Windows SDK.

Gereksinimler

Başlık: afxwin.h

Ayrıca bkz.

Başvuru

CDC Sınıfı

Hiyerarşi grafik

CDC::GetTextExtentPointI